Chamber Referrals and Listings
Receiving myriad inquiries each year from newcomers, visitors, and businesses, the Chamber refers only member businesses.
All Chamber member businesses are listed in our annual Business Resource Guide and Membership Directory which every Chamber member receives and is sold to newcomers moving to the area. Advertising is sold in this directory to Chamber members, and is an excellent way to promote your business. The Chamber also provides its membership directory on the Internet as part of the Chamber's Web site, offering members exposure worldwide.
The Chamber also publishes a monthly newspaper, the Carlsbad Business Journal, which is mailed to every member and hand delivered to every business in the City of Carlsbad. You can also find the Carlsbad Business Journal in nearly 100 racks throughout Carlsbad and San Diego. The CBJ offers unique advertising and marketing opportunities for Chamber members. The Chamber has received numerous awards from the Western Association of Chamber Executives and most recently from the San Diego Press Club.

Small Business Success Center
In addition to encouraging entrepreneurship through networking opportunities, publications, luncheons, seminars, and expos, the Chamber also works in cooperation with SCORE to help members obtain valuable resources needed to run a profitable small business. The Carlsbad Chamber is one of the few chambers in California that houses its very own Small Business Success Center.
Tax Deduction
Membership dues are 98 percent tax-deductible as an ordinary and necessary business expense for federal income tax purposes. However, dues are not considered charitable tax deductions.
